There are several libraries in haskell for abstract algebra but they
don't seem to cover my use case I was wondering if other people have had
similar issues and if there are any packages I am missing.
What I am prinicpaly interested in is operation on algebraic stuctures
(homomorphisms, kernels, quotients, colimits, etc) whereas most algebra
packages seem to just give operations on the elements of an algebraic
structure.
So I would like to be able to write something like...
g = freeGroup(["x","y"])
h = freeGroup(["z"])
phi = grpMorphismOnGens([("x","z"^6) , ("y","z")])
k = grpKernel phi
(gens,rels) = grpPresentation (grpQuotient g k)
